The Forever One

Your First Love Always Owns the Most of Your Heart

2008

Help me, my love, for I am confused

By all the outside influences fused.

Elders, teachers, preachers, and all

Say our love will not last at all.

They say our love is only small,

But tell, my love, the lie is tall.

Say our love is forever; seal it with a kiss.

But, my love, there is something I cannot hide.

A feeling inside which doubts our love.

Be not fearful. For take feeling as it is, a feeling.

Put no foundation in a feeling,

Nor images of stone upon emotion.

For feelings and emotions swell as the tide;

So cast down these and tell how love is true.

The kind spoken in sonnet one-sixteen.

I know that you are the one.

I know for certain there is no other.

No one as lovely, nor as special.

Thank you, my love, for being honest;

Not with your words, but with your eyes.

Your eyes are as amber wells of truth,

That speak far louder than any vocal key.

And if they could truly speak would say,

There is no doubt within the heart.

You are the only, and forever, one for me.
